The FV601 Saladin was Britain's principal 6x6 wheeled armoured car of the Cold War, built by Alvis and entering service in 1958. Armed with a 76mm high-velocity gun and riding on fully independent suspension, it combined real firepower with the speed and low running costs of a wheeled chassis, serving with the British Army into the 1970s and with more than a dozen export customers across the Middle East and Africa well into the 1990s.
Dragon's 1/35 kit renders the Saladin's distinctive six-wheel layout, sloped hull glacis and low, rounded turret with crisply moulded panel lines and hatch detail, using the slide-mould technology the company is known for to keep the gun barrel and turret castings free of unsightly seams.
The kit includes detailed suspension and steering components for all three axles, a fully detailed 76mm main gun, and a decal sheet covering authentic British Army and export markings so builders can choose the livery that suits their diorama or collection.
An unusual wheeled subject alongside the more common tracked AFVs in Dragon's range, this Saladin is a great pick for Cold War armour collectors and anyone wanting to add a British reconnaissance vehicle to a mixed-nation display.
